FIGURE 2:
FRONT PANEL AND DISK LOCATIONS
The DD620 has either seven or twelve hot-swappable 1 TB disk
drives, depending on configuration. Disk drive carriers are numbered
left to right and top to bottom, as shown in the illustration.
Unused drive slots contain blank carriers.

Front Operator Panel Buttons
Push Button
Definition
Power
Press Power button to turn on system power when the Alert/ID LED is blue.
If the blue LED is not lit within one minute after AC power is applied to the power
supplies, please contact Support (see contact information at the end of this
document).
Never shut down the system by pressing the Power button.
Enclosure ID
Press the Enclosure ID button to light a blue LED in the front and rear to ID the
chassis in a rack.
